If any item, such as your paddle, hat, or towel, falls onto your side of the pickleball court, then no fault occurs unless such item lands in the Non-Volley Zone as a result of hitting a volley. Some common ways a fault could arise include, without limitation: - A fault could occur if the broken paddle or other lost item lands in the Non-Volley Zone (also known as the Kitchen) and the pickleball did not bounce - in other words, the broken paddle or other lost item lands in the Non-Volley Zone in connection with a volley. The Carolina Wren (Thryothorus ludovicianus) is a common species of wren that is resident in the eastern half of the United States, the extreme south of Ontario and Quebec, Canada, and the extreme northeast of Mexico.
